Sunday, September 6 | The Burmese Harp (1956)
A Kon Ichikawa Film
An Imperial Japanese Army regiment surrenders to British forces in Burma at the close of World War II and finds harmony through song. A private, thought to be dead, disguises himself as a Buddhist monk and stumbles upon spiritual enlightenment. The film is regarded as an elegant meditation on beauty coexisting with death and remains one of Japanese cinema’s most overwhelming antiwar sentiments, both tender and brutal in its grappling with Japan’s wartime legacy. B&W. In Japanese and Burmese with English Subtitles

Sunday, September 20, 2026 | Man in the Train (2003)
A Patrice LeConte Film
A mysterious stranger is the lone passenger disembarking from a train in a sleepy French village. His name is Milan, a criminal intent on knocking over a local bank. Upon his arrival, he is befriended by Manesquier, a retired poetry teacher. Through their unexpected friendship, both men realize they have been given the opportunity to look back on their lives — complete with dashed hopes and unfulfilled dreams. At the same time, both are given the momentary chance to explore the road not taken. Best Picture and Best Actor winner at the 2002 Venice Film Festival. In French with English Subtitles.
